WebInformation and services. Most courses at UQ use a numbering system for final grades, with 7 as the highest possible grade and 1, 2, and 3 as failing grades. Grades may also be expressed as letters, or as a combination of letters, numbers and symbols. For a complete list of final grades and what they mean, see the Grading System Procedures.
